Mediterranean Salmon Bake Ingredients

  • For the Salmon
    Salmon Fillets – The star of this dish; fresh Atlantic or wild-caught Alaskan ensures the best flavor and texture.

  • For the Toppings
    Cherry Tomatoes – Adds a sweet burst; halved for optimal juiciness and even cooking.
    Kalamata Olives – Brings a savory depth; substitute with green olives if you prefer a milder flavor.
    Feta Cheese – Offers a creamy tang; for a dairy-free alternative, use plant-based feta or omit entirely.
    Garlic – Infuses the dish with aromatic goodness; fresh minced garlic is ideal for maximum flavor.
    Fresh Dill – Provides a fresh and fragrant touch; feel free to swap with parsley or basil based on your preference.
    Pesto Sauce – Adds a herby richness; use your favorite store-bought variety or whip up some homemade.
    Lemon – Brightens and balances flavors beautifully; fresh slices should be tucked around the salmon for zesty flair.
    Olive Oil – Keeps the salmon moist and adds robustness; extra-virgin is preferred for depth of flavor.
    Salt & Pepper – Essential for seasoning; adjust according to your taste.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Mediterranean Salmon Bake

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). While the oven warms up, line a baking sheet with parchment paper or foil, then lightly grease it with a drizzle of olive oil. This preparation will ensure your Mediterranean Salmon Bake comes out beautifully without sticking, making cleanup super easy later on.

Step 2: Arrange the Salmon
Place the salmon fillets skin-side down on the prepared baking sheet. Take a moment to season each fillet generously with salt and pepper, ensuring that the seasoning is evenly distributed. This step is essential for enhancing the flavor of your dish, as the salmon will absorb the seasoning as it bakes.

Step 3: Add the Pesto
Spoon a generous amount of pesto evenly over each fillet, allowing it to coat the salmon completely. The vibrant green pesto not only adds a rich herby flavor but also helps to keep the fish moist during baking. Spread it with the back of the spoon for an even layer, ensuring each bite of your Mediterranean Salmon Bake will be full of flavor.

Step 4: Layer the Toppings
Top the salmon with halved cherry tomatoes, sliced Kalamata olives, crumbled feta cheese, and minced garlic. Scatter these toppings evenly across the fillets to create a colorful and appetizing display. The combination of sweet tomatoes and savory olives will elevate the flavor profile of your Mediterranean Salmon Bake and invite everyone to dig in!

Step 5: Add Lemon and Olive Oil
Arrange fresh lemon slices around the salmon, adding a zesty brightness to the dish. Drizzle a little more olive oil over the toppings to enhance the flavors and promote golden browning as it bakes. The lemon will infuse the salmon with its fresh juice, balancing the richness of the feta and olives beautifully.

Step 6: Bake the Salmon
Place the baking sheet in the preheated oven and bake for 15-18 minutes. Keep an eye on your Mediterranean Salmon Bake; it’s ready when the salmon flakes easily with a fork and the toppings are golden and bubbly. The delicious aromas filling your kitchen will be the perfect indicator that dinner is almost here!

Step 7: Rest and Serve
Once baked, remove the salmon from the oven and let it rest for 2-3 minutes. This resting time allows the juices to redistribute, making the salmon even more tender. Before serving, spoon some of the pan juices over the top for added flavor, and enjoy this beautiful Mediterranean Salmon Bake with your favorite sides!

Expert Tips for Mediterranean Salmon Bake

  • Choose Fresh Salmon: Use fresh Atlantic or wild-caught Alaskan salmon for the best flavor and texture; avoid frozen fillets which may differ in quality.
  • Uniform Thickness: Select salmon fillets that are similar in thickness to ensure even baking; this prevents some pieces from overcooking while others are still underdone.
  • Watch the Clock: Start checking your Mediterranean Salmon Bake at the 15-minute mark to avoid overcooking; perfectly baked salmon should flake easily with a fork.
  • Golden Toppings: Let the toppings bake until they’re golden for enhanced flavor and visual appeal. If necessary, give them an extra minute or two at the end!
  • Meal Prep Ready: For convenient meal prep, assemble the salmon and toppings ahead of time, cover, refrigerate, and bake just before serving for a fresh taste.

How to Store and Freeze Mediterranean Salmon Bake

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days. This keeps your Mediterranean Salmon Bake fresh and ready to enjoy for quick meals.

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the cooled salmon bake in an airtight container for up to 2 months. To prevent freezer burn, wrap it tightly with plastic wrap before sealing.

Reheating: When ready to eat, thaw overnight in the fridge, then reheat in a 350°F (175°C) oven for about 15-20 minutes. This helps restore flavor and texture.

Make Ahead Options

These Mediterranean Salmon Bakes are perfect for meal prep enthusiasts seeking to save time during busy weeknights! You can prepare the salmon with all the toppings—cherry tomatoes, olives, feta, and garlic—up to 24 hours in advance. Simply assemble the dish on a lined baking sheet, cover it tightly with plastic wrap, and refrigerate. This not only enhances the flavors but also keeps the ingredients fresh. When you’re ready to bake, just pop it into a preheated oven at 400°F (200°C) for 15-18 minutes as directed. Mediterranean Salmon Bake Recipe FAQs

What kind of salmon should I use for the Mediterranean Salmon Bake?
Absolutely! For the best flavor and texture, I recommend using fresh Atlantic or wild-caught Alaskan salmon. Ensure the fillets are similar in thickness; this will help them bake evenly and avoid overcooking.

How should I store leftover Mediterranean Salmon Bake?
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Just make sure to let it cool to room temperature before sealing. This way, you can enjoy your Mediterranean Salmon Bake later without compromising on flavor!

Can I freeze Mediterranean Salmon Bake? How do I do it?
Yes, you can freeze it! Once cooled, wrap the salmon bake tightly in plastic wrap, then place it in an airtight container or a freezer bag. It can keep in the freezer for up to 2 months. When you’re ready to enjoy it, thaw overnight in the fridge, then reheat in a 350°F (175°C) oven for about 15-20 minutes for the best results.

What if my salmon is overcooked? How can I avoid that?
To avoid overcooking your salmon, start checking it at the 15-minute mark. Look for the salmon to flake easily with a fork; it should still be slightly translucent in the center. If you find it’s dried out, that’s usually a sign it’s been in the oven too long. Monitoring carefully will lead to perfect results every time!

Can I make the Mediterranean Salmon Bake dairy-free?
Very! Simply substitute the feta cheese with a plant-based feta alternative, or omit it entirely. The rest of the flavors, especially the pesto and olives, will still create a delicious dish that everyone can enjoy irrespective of dietary preferences.

Is it safe for my pets?
It’s best to keep this dish away from pets due to its ingredients like garlic, which can be harmful to dogs and cats. Always check what’s safe before treating your furry friends to any leftovers!

Mediterranean Salmon Bake

Mediterranean Salmon Bake: A Flavor-Packed Weeknight Delight

Mediterranean Salmon Bake combines juicy cherry tomatoes, briny olives, and creamy feta atop perfectly baked salmon—a quick and heart-healthy weeknight dish.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 18 minutes
Resting Time 3 minutes
Total Time 31 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Dinner Ideas
Cuisine: Mediterranean
Calories: 350

Ingredients
  

For the Salmon
  • 4 fillets Salmon Fresh Atlantic or wild-caught Alaskan recommended.
For the Toppings
  • 2 cups Cherry Tomatoes Halved for optimal juiciness.
  • 1 cup Kalamata Olives Substitute with green olives if preferred.
  • 1 cup Feta Cheese Use plant-based feta for dairy-free option.
  • 4 cloves Garlic Minced.
  • 1 tablespoon Fresh Dill Can substitute with parsley or basil.
  • 1/2 cup Pesto Sauce Store-bought or homemade.
  • 1 whole Lemon Sliced.
  • 2 tablespoons Olive Oil Extra-virgin preferred.
  • to taste Salt
  • to taste Pepper

Equipment

  • Oven
  • Baking sheet
  • Parchment paper or foil
  • Spoon

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or foil, and lightly grease it with olive oil.
  2. Place the salmon fillets skin-side down on the prepared baking sheet. Season generously with salt and pepper.
  3. Spoon pesto evenly over each fillet until coated completely.
  4. Top salmon with halved cherry tomatoes, sliced olives, crumbled feta, and minced garlic.
  5. Arrange lemon slices around the salmon and drizzle more olive oil over the toppings.
  6. Bake for 15-18 minutes until salmon flakes easily and toppings are golden.
  7. Remove from the oven, let rest for 2-3 minutes, then serve with pan juices.
